Can I Run Library Simulator?
The minimum memory requirement for Library Simulator is 6 GB of RAM installed in your computer. An Intel Core i5-12400T CPU is required at a minimum to run Library Simulator. The cheapest graphics card you can play it on is an NVIDIA GeForce GTX 1050. You will need at least 7 GB of free disk space to install Library Simulator.
Library Simulator will run on PC system with Windows 10, Windows 11 and upwards.
